气动葫芦吊用短环链的链环断裂原因分析  被引量:1

摘  要:针对一起气动葫芦吊用短环链中的链环断裂失效案例,对链环进行宏观检查、化学成分分析、显微组织分析、硬度分析、断口显微分析.结果表明:链环断裂主要与链环局部组织过热造成的晶界弱化以及显微组织中存在的块状铁素体造成的性能下降有关,然后在大应力的作用下发生脆性断裂.最后,针对如何减少甚至避免类似事件再次发生,提出相关建议.In view of the case of chain link fracture failure of short-link chain for pneumatic hoist,the fracture chain link was analyzed by means of macroscopic examination,chemical composition analysis,microstructure analysis,hardness analysis and fracture micro analysis.The results show that the main reason for the chain link fracture was related to the weakening of the grain boundary caused by the overheating of local structure of the chain link and the decrease of properties caused by the existence of massive ferrite in the microstructure,and then brittle fracture occured under the action of large stress.Finally,some suggestions were put forward on how to reduce or even avoid the recurrence of similar events.
